Description

The Range Trail connects three iconic Adirondack high peaks; Upper Wolfjaw, Armstrong and Gothics. While not for the faint of heart, the effort that you put into this trail is certainly worth the views and the bragging rights.

As with many Adirondack trails, don't expect too many switchbacks, and much of your elevation gain will be made in scrambles up technical, rocky faces. Treacherous even in the best of conditions, the trails deteriorate in the rain, leaving them muddy and slick. Appropriate caution should be taken, but experienced hikers won't have too much of a problem on this trail.
